Sergio Martino’s ‘Torso’ Hacks Its Way to Blu-ray
Shameless Films is set to keep their streak of Sergio Martino films alive when they release Torso on Blu-ray (Yell-O-Ray in the Shameless world) on September 25th. And if you’re concerned with the fact that Shameless is UK-based, you need not worry because this release is region free!
As Shameless always does, they are releasing the most complete version of the film possible — this means inserting a few scenes that are only available in Italian but with English subtitles. And unique to this Blu-ray release, Shameless has reinserted a few short pieces footage which shows on-screen text. Thought lost, these clips have since been recovered from the vaults and now show important narrative details in English, having previously been written in Italian.

Brazilian Werewolf Fable ‘Good Manners’ Finally Gets Physical Media Release
One of contemporary horror’s best werewolf movies is 2017’s Good Manners, and it’s finally set to receive a proper physical media release.
Icarus Films is partnering with OCN Distribution to unleash a new Blu-ray that’s now available to preorder via Vinegar Syndrome. and with a limited edition slipcover.
Set in São Paulo, the film follows Clara, a lonely nurse from the outskirts of the city who is hired by mysterious and wealthy Ana to be the nanny of her soon to be born child. Against all odds, the two women develop a strong bond. But a fateful night marked by a full moon changes their plans.
Good Manners is the second collaboration between filmmakers Juliana Rojas and Marco Dutra, who write and direct. Zama’s Rui Poças‘ cinematography captures this unique werewolf tale described as “Disney meets Jacques Tourneur.”
Our own Trace Thurman wrote in his review, “With Good Manners, Rojas and Dutro have made one of the best werewolf movies ever made. That they are able juggle commentaries on racism and classism while still managing to tell two deeply affecting love stories is remarkable.”
